Faliraki Beach is a vibrant and expansive stretch of golden sand, approximately 5 kilometers long, located in the town of Faliraki, Rhodes, Greece. It is renowned for its clear, crystalline waters and offers a variety of activities such as swimming, sunbathing, jet skiing, and beach volleyball. The beach caters to a wide audience, from families seeking calm waters to couples and groups of friends looking for a lively atmosphere. In the evenings, visitors can enjoy a range of bars, restaurants, and clubs along the beachfront. Faliraki has transformed over the years, evolving from a party destination to a more family-friendly resort with improved infrastructure and diverse attractions.
The beach is well-maintained with public areas, zones reserved for hotel guests, and facilities to rent sun loungers and umbrellas. It is a Blue Flag beach, recognized for its cleanliness and environmental quality. Nearby attractions include the Faliraki Water Park, one of Europe's largest, and historical sites like the village of Kalithies.
Faliraki's proximity to Rhodes International Airport, just a 20-minute drive away, makes it easily accessible for travelers. The area offers a mix of relaxation and entertainment, making it a popular destination for all ages.
